Johns Manville Fernley, Nevada plant located just outside of Reno (30 miles) is seeking a Plant Engineer to join our team. This is an exciting opportunity to coach, mentor and lead teams. The Plant Engineer is responsible for overseeing/maintaining maintenance and engineering functions for a single manufacturing facility. The Plant Engineer is responsible for all aspects of capital and maintenance budgets for the facility including but not limited to the following: Capex budgeting and management; development of long-term Capex budgeting; monthly reporting for Capex spends; monthly review of maintenance and facility spend; equipment improvements, equipment reliability; supporting and driving productivity improvements, managing and staffing of the Maintenance department; and energy management.
The Fernley plant manufactures polyisocyanurate foam insulation panels for use in both commercial and residential roofing systems. Rigid foam panels are produced inline on an automated production line.
